THUNDER BAY — City police arrested five people during a drug bust at two south side homes over the weekend.
Thunder Bay police said two search warrants were executed on Saturday, one at a residential address on the 900 block of Syndicate Avenue South and the second at a residential address on the 2100 block of McGregor Avenue.
Police seized what they described as a significant quantity of suspected cocaine, along with cash and paraphernalia consistent with drug trafficking. The drugs have an estimated street value of nearly $135,000, while the cash seized amounted to more than $16,500.
Five suspects were identified and arrested, including one who attempted to flee from officers but was later found in the Christina Street area.
All five, which include a 25-year-old from Victoria, B.C., a 35-year-old from Brampton, and a 17-year-old from Brampton, are charged with one count of drug possession for the purpose of trafficking and possession of property obtained by crime over $5,000.
